GDP and Classical Model Closed economy
1. Is GDP a good measure of economic welfare? List and explain SEVEN important types of
economic activity that it doesn’t include.
2. Consider how each of the following events is likely to affect the real GDP of the country
concerned. Do you think the change in real GDP reflects a similar change in economic well-
being?
(a) A freak hurricane in northern France forces Disneyland Paris to shut down for a
month.
(b) The discovery of a new easy-to-grow strain of wheat increases British farm harvests.
(c) Increased hostility between unions and management sparks a rash of strikes in Italy.
(d) Firms throughout the German economy experience falling demand, causing them to
lay off workers.
(e) The European Parliament passes new environmental laws that prohibit EU firms
from using production methods that emit large quantities of pollution.
(f) More Irish university students drop out of university to take jobs painting houses.
(g) Greek fathers reduce their working weeks in order to spend more time with their
children.
3. In a country the unemployment rate is 6 per cent. If the population is 300 million, the
number unemployed is 6 million and the number employed is 94 million, what is the size of
the workforce?
